Encourages development of sociological imagination (thinking and using tools like a sociologist) in a global context. Comprehensive and research-based. Four important features: With Sociological Imagination provides in-depth analysis of a sociological ideas; Cohesion, Conflict and Meaning compares and contrasts the three primary theoretical viewpoints (structural-functionalism, conflict theory, and symbolic interactionism); Social Diversity examines issues as they apply to a multicultural America; and In Global Perspective applies sociological ideas to global issues. Internet exercises conclude each chapter.
